C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
不看会后悔的Windows XP之经验谈 简单快捷DIY实用家庭影院
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  Delphi >  VCL组件开发及应用

treeview问题

楼主rose5178(太阳鸟)2005-04-03 21:50:58 在 Delphi / VCL组件开发及应用 提问

treeview控件,grid控件放在frame1上,frame1放在form上,frame2挡在前面。  
  利用form上的mainmenu的click事件调用bringtofront来显示frame1  
  数据库使用ADO连接  
   
  treeview:                
  -school                                
      |-grade1                            
      |       |-class1                    
      |       |-class2                    
      |       |-class3                    
      |                                          
      |-grade2                            
      |       |-class4                    
      |       |-class5                      
      |       |-class6                    
      +-grade3                          
      |                                            
      +-grade4                          
  要求:grade从grade表中动态读出,class从class表中动态读出,  
  两表可以add,delete,updata。调用bringtofront时,刷新treeview。  
  student表为学生名。  
  在treeview中:  
  点school   ,grid显示全校学生名,点grade   ,grid显示该年级学生名,  
  点class   ,grid显示该班级学生名 问题点数:20、回复次数:2Top

1 楼xinshiji(自由我有)回复于 2005-04-04 02:19:34 得分 15

你可以动态的加载,在formshow中动态的将class,grade的数据添加到treeview中,最好是做成函数,刷新的时候重新加载(直接调用函数)Top

2 楼heluqing(鉴之小河〖劳累求充实〗)(vcl .net)回复于 2005-04-04 09:22:23 得分 5

支持楼上  
  如果数据量比较大的话,可以尝试做个加载等待窗口...Top

相关问题

  • TreeView?
  • Treeview??
  • treeview
  • treeview
  • TREEVIEW
  • treeview
  • treeview
  • TreeView
  • TreeView
  • about TreeView

关键词

  • grid
  • 学生
  • grade
  • treeview
  • 加载
  • 调用
  • 表
  • 动态
  • 显示
  • frame

得分解答快速导航

  • 帖主:rose5178
  • xinshiji
  • heluqing

相关链接

  • Delphi类图书
  • Delphi类源码下载
  • Delphi控件下载

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
北京创新乐知广告有限公司 版权所有, 京 ICP 证 070598 号
世纪乐知(北京)网络技术有限公司 提供技术支持
Copyright © 2000-2008, CSDN.NET, All Rights Reserved
GongshangLogo